Illegal dumping at Mayo graveyard condemned

ILLEGAL dumping at Castlebar’s old graveyard has been condemned by the local Tidy Towns voluntary workers who carry out regular clean-ups of the area.

Last week dozens of empty cider cans were discovered dumped on one grave plot.

“I would highly condemn those responsible as it defeats the weekly clean-up by the volunteers,” said Councillor Ger Deere, one of the leading tidy towns campaigners.

He added: “Those responsible must be unaware of the Return Scheme where they can reclaim deposits on their cans.

“It is really disheartening to see such dumping in the graveyard where such great efforts are being made to keep the place tidy and litter-free.”
